Expert Guide to the Objectives of Financial Leverage Calculation
Financial leverage calculation is one of the most important tools in corporate finance because it connects a firm’s financing choices with shareholder returns, risk exposure, and long-term capital structure efficiency. In simple terms, financial leverage refers to the use of borrowed funds to finance assets or operations. The objective is not merely to borrow money. The real objective is to determine whether debt helps the business produce a higher return for owners than it would under an all-equity structure, while still maintaining adequate financial safety.
When a company adds debt, it creates fixed financial obligations, usually in the form of interest payments. If operating income stays strong, those fixed costs can magnify the return earned on equity. If operating income weakens, however, the same fixed costs can magnify losses and put pressure on liquidity. That is why the objectives of financial leverage calculation go well beyond a single ratio. A strong evaluation looks at return on equity, tax advantages, earnings sensitivity, coverage protection, and the sustainability of debt service across different business conditions.
What Are the Main Objectives of Financial Leverage Calculation?
The phrase “objectives of financial leverage calculation” generally refers to the reasons analysts, business owners, and investors calculate leverage-related metrics before making financing decisions. These objectives usually include the following:
- Enhancing shareholder return: Debt can increase return on equity when the return generated from assets exceeds the after-tax cost of borrowing.
- Measuring risk from fixed obligations: Interest must be paid regardless of sales volatility, so leverage calculations help estimate downside risk.
- Estimating tax benefits: In many tax systems, interest expense reduces taxable income, creating a tax shield.
- Testing capital structure efficiency: Firms want to know whether debt and equity are being combined in a way that minimizes overall cost of capital.
- Comparing financing alternatives: Management can compare an all-equity plan against a leveraged plan before issuing debt.
- Monitoring lender confidence: Ratios such as interest coverage indicate whether the business can comfortably meet financial commitments.
Core Measures Used in Financial Leverage Analysis
Different finance teams use slightly different frameworks, but the most common calculations include these building blocks:
- Interest Expense: Debt multiplied by the annual interest rate.
- Earnings Before Tax: EBIT minus interest expense.
- Net Income: Earnings before tax multiplied by one minus the tax rate.
- Return on Equity: Net income divided by equity capital.
- Tax Shield: Interest expense multiplied by the corporate tax rate.
- Interest Coverage Ratio: EBIT divided by interest expense.
- Degree of Financial Leverage: EBIT divided by EBIT minus interest. This shows how sensitive earnings available to owners are to changes in operating income.

Why Companies Use Debt in the First Place
Debt financing remains popular because it can be cheaper than issuing more equity, especially for companies with stable cash flow and access to reasonably priced credit. Equity holders require a return that is often higher than lender interest rates because equity sits lower in the capital stack and takes more risk. Debt also allows existing owners to avoid diluting control. For a founder-led or family-owned firm, that control objective can be strategically significant.
Another important objective is tax efficiency. Under the U.S. tax system, interest expense generally reduces taxable income, which can lower effective financing cost. Comparison Table: Same Business, Different Capital Structures
The table below shows a sample scenario similar to the logic used in the calculator. The figures demonstrate how debt can increase shareholder return while also increasing earnings sensitivity and fixed-payment risk.
| Metric | All-Equity Structure | Leveraged Structure | What It Tells You |
|---|---|---|---|
| EBIT | $500,000 | $500,000 | Operating performance is identical in both cases. |
| Debt | $0 | $800,000 | The leveraged firm introduces fixed financing cost. |
| Interest Rate | 0% | 7.5% | Borrowing cost determines whether leverage is beneficial. |
| Interest Expense | $0 | $60,000 | Debt adds mandatory annual cash outflow. |
| Net Income at 21% tax | $395,000 | $347,600 | Income falls after interest, but equity is also lower than a full-equity approach. |
| Equity Base | $2,000,000 | $1,200,000 | Less equity can amplify owner returns. |
| ROE | 19.75% | 28.97% | Leverage improves shareholder return in this example. |
| Interest Coverage | Not applicable | 8.33x | Coverage suggests debt is manageable, though not risk free. |
Strategic Objectives Behind Calculating Financial Leverage
Financial leverage calculations are not performed only for textbook purposes. Management teams use them to answer strategic questions, such as:
- Can the company fund expansion without diluting current owners?
- Would adding debt improve return on equity enough to satisfy investors?
- Is there enough operating income stability to support fixed interest costs during a downturn?
- Will lenders remain comfortable with the company’s coverage and solvency profile?
- Does the tax shield create a meaningful reduction in effective capital cost?
In acquisition finance, project finance, real estate, manufacturing, and private equity, leverage calculations are central because debt can substantially improve equity returns when the asset generates reliable cash flow. However, highly cyclical sectors, start-ups, and turnaround situations usually require more conservative leverage because EBIT volatility can make fixed charges dangerous.
Advantages of Financial Leverage
- Higher potential ROE: If returns on invested capital exceed debt cost, owners can benefit disproportionately.
- Tax efficiency: Interest deductibility lowers taxable income in many jurisdictions.
- Preserved ownership control: Debt avoids or reduces equity dilution.
- Better capital allocation: Firms may keep equity available for strategic flexibility while using debt for growth projects.
Risks and Limitations
- Downside magnification: A fall in EBIT can sharply reduce earnings to equity holders.
- Liquidity stress: Interest and principal payments must be met even if sales weaken.
- Covenant constraints: Lenders may restrict dividends, new borrowing, or capital spending.
- Refinancing risk: Maturing debt may become more expensive if market rates rise.
Best Practices When Using a Leverage Calculator
- Run multiple EBIT scenarios, including a downside case and a recession case.
- Compare fixed-rate and floating-rate borrowing assumptions.
- Do not rely on ROE alone; always examine interest coverage and debt service resilience.
- Use realistic tax assumptions based on the company’s actual jurisdiction and deductions.
- Review debt maturity timing and refinancing exposure, not just annual interest cost.
